*{margin:0;padding:0;box-sizing:border-box}body{font-family:Courier New,Courier,Lucida Console,Monaco,monospace;background:#0a0e14;min-height:100vh;color:#0f0;line-height:1.6}.app.svelte-1uha8ag{min-height:100vh;display:flex;flex-direction:column}.header.svelte-1uha8ag{background:#000;border-bottom:2px solid #00ff00;padding:1.5rem 0;box-shadow:0 0 20px #0f03}.header-content.svelte-1uha8ag{max-width:1400px;margin:0 auto;padding:0 2rem;display:flex;justify-content:space-between;align-items:center}.logo-section.svelte-1uha8ag{display:flex;align-items:center;gap:1rem}.logo-icon.svelte-1uha8ag{color:#0f0;filter:drop-shadow(0 0 10px #00ff00)}.title.svelte-1uha8ag{font-size:2rem;font-weight:700;color:#0f0;letter-spacing:.1em;text-shadow:0 0 10px #00ff00}.subtitle.svelte-1uha8ag{font-size:.875rem;color:#0a0;letter-spacing:.05em}.badge.svelte-1uha8ag{display:flex;align-items:center;gap:.5rem;background:#00ff001a;padding:.5rem 1rem;border-radius:4px;border:1px solid #00ff00;font-size:.875rem;color:#0f0;font-weight:600}.coffee-btn.svelte-1uha8ag{display:flex;align-items:center;gap:.5rem;background:#ffc1071a;padding:.5rem 1rem;border-radius:4px;border:1px solid #ffc107;font-size:.875rem;color:#ffc107;font-weight:600;text-decoration:none;transition:all .3s ease;cursor:pointer}.coffee-btn.svelte-1uha8ag:hover{background:#ffc10733;box-shadow:0 0 10px #ffc10766;transform:translateY(-2px)}.container.svelte-1uha8ag{flex:1;max-width:1200px;width:100%;margin:0 auto;padding:2rem}.session-error-banner.svelte-1uha8ag,.session-loading-banner.svelte-1uha8ag,.session-success-banner.svelte-1uha8ag{display:flex;align-items:center;gap:1rem;border:1px solid #00ff00;padding:1rem;margin-bottom:2rem;background:#00ff000d;color:#0f0}.error-banner.svelte-1uha8ag{display:flex;align-items:center;gap:1rem;background:#ff00001a;border:1px solid #ff0000;padding:1rem;margin-bottom:2rem;color:red}.steps.svelte-1uha8ag{display:flex;justify-content:center;margin-bottom:3rem;gap:1rem}.step-item.svelte-1uha8ag{display:flex;align-items:center;gap:.5rem;color:#0a0;font-size:.875rem}.step-item.active.svelte-1uha8ag{color:#0f0;text-shadow:0 0 5px #00ff00}.step-item.complete.svelte-1uha8ag{color:#0f0}.step-number.svelte-1uha8ag{width:32px;height:32px;border:1px solid #00ff00;display:flex;align-items:center;justify-content:center;font-weight:600;background:#00ff001a}.step-item.active.svelte-1uha8ag .step-number:where(.svelte-1uha8ag){background:#0f0;color:#000;box-shadow:0 0 10px #0f0}.step-line.svelte-1uha8ag{width:60px;height:1px;background:#0a0;margin:0 .5rem}.step-line.complete.svelte-1uha8ag{background:#0f0}.card.svelte-1uha8ag{background:#00ff0005;border:1px solid #00ff00;padding:2rem;margin-bottom:2rem}.card-title.svelte-1uha8ag{font-size:1.5rem;font-weight:700;color:#0f0;margin-bottom:2rem;display:flex;align-items:center;gap:.75rem;text-shadow:0 0 5px #00ff00}.info-box.svelte-1uha8ag{display:flex;gap:1rem;padding:1rem;margin-bottom:1.5rem;background:#00ff000d;border-left:3px solid #00ff00;color:#0f0}.info-box.warning.svelte-1uha8ag{border-left-color:#fa0;background:#ffaa000d;color:#fa0}.info-box.svelte-1uha8ag code:where(.svelte-1uha8ag){background:#000;padding:.25rem .5rem;border:1px solid #00ff00;color:#0f0;font-family:inherit}.input-group.svelte-1uha8ag{margin-bottom:1.5rem}.input-group.svelte-1uha8ag label:where(.svelte-1uha8ag){display:flex;align-items:center;gap:.5rem;margin-bottom:.5rem;color:#0f0;font-weight:600;font-size:.875rem}.input-field.svelte-1uha8ag,select.svelte-1uha8ag,input[type=text].svelte-1uha8ag,input[type=number].svelte-1uha8ag{width:100%;padding:.75rem;background:#000;border:1px solid #00ff00;color:#0f0;font-family:Courier New,Courier,monospace;font-size:1rem;outline:none}.input-field.svelte-1uha8ag:focus,select.svelte-1uha8ag:focus,input.svelte-1uha8ag:focus{box-shadow:0 0 10px #00ff004d;border-color:#0f0}.input-field.svelte-1uha8ag::placeholder{color:#0a0}.btn.svelte-1uha8ag{display:inline-flex;align-items:center;gap:.5rem;padding:.75rem 1.5rem;background:#00ff001a;border:1px solid #00ff00;color:#0f0;font-family:inherit;font-size:1rem;font-weight:600;cursor:pointer;transition:all .2s}.btn.svelte-1uha8ag:hover:not(:disabled){background:#0f0;color:#000;box-shadow:0 0 20px #00ff0080}.btn.svelte-1uha8ag:disabled{opacity:.3;cursor:not-allowed}.btn-primary.svelte-1uha8ag,.btn-success.svelte-1uha8ag{background:#0f03}.btn-secondary.svelte-1uha8ag{background:#ffaa001a;border-color:#fa0;color:#fa0}.btn-secondary.svelte-1uha8ag:hover:not(:disabled){background:#fa0;color:#000}.btn-large.svelte-1uha8ag{padding:1rem 2rem;font-size:1.125rem}.btn-sm.svelte-1uha8ag{padding:.5rem 1rem;font-size:.875rem}.card-actions.svelte-1uha8ag{display:flex;gap:1rem;margin-top:2rem;justify-content:flex-end}.presets.svelte-1uha8ag{margin-bottom:2rem}.preset-title.svelte-1uha8ag{font-size:1rem;color:#0f0;margin-bottom:1rem;display:flex;align-items:center;gap:.5rem}.preset-grid.svelte-1uha8ag{display:grid;grid-template-columns:repeat(auto-fit,minmax(150px,1fr));gap:.75rem}.preset-btn.svelte-1uha8ag{padding:.75rem;background:#00ff000d;border:1px solid #00ff00;color:#0f0;font-family:inherit;font-size:.875rem;font-weight:600;cursor:pointer;transition:all .2s}.preset-btn.svelte-1uha8ag:hover{background:#0f0;color:#000}.config-section.svelte-1uha8ag{margin-bottom:2rem}.config-section.svelte-1uha8ag h3:where(.svelte-1uha8ag){font-size:1rem;color:#0f0;margin-bottom:1rem}.checkbox-grid.svelte-1uha8ag{display:grid;grid-template-columns:repeat(auto-fill,minmax(200px,1fr));gap:.75rem}.checkbox.svelte-1uha8ag{display:flex;align-items:center;gap:.5rem;padding:.5rem;background:#00ff0005;border:1px solid rgba(0,255,0,.2);cursor:pointer;font-size:.875rem;color:#0f0}.checkbox.svelte-1uha8ag:hover{background:#00ff001a}.checkbox.svelte-1uha8ag input[type=checkbox]:where(.svelte-1uha8ag){width:16px;height:16px;cursor:pointer;accent-color:#00ff00}.processing-card.svelte-1uha8ag{text-align:center;padding:3rem 2rem}.spinner.svelte-1uha8ag{animation:svelte-1uha8ag-spin 1s linear infinite;color:#0f0;filter:drop-shadow(0 0 10px #00ff00)}@keyframes svelte-1uha8ag-sp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}.progress-bar.svelte-1uha8ag{height:100%;background:#0f0;transition:width .3s ease;box-shadow:0 0 10px #0f0}.summary-grid.svelte-1uha8ag{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:1rem;margin-bottom:2rem}.summary-card.svelte-1uha8ag{background:#00ff000d;border:1px solid #00ff00;padding:1.5rem;text-align:center}.summary-icon.svelte-1uha8ag{color:#0f0;margin-bottom:.5rem;font-size:1.5rem}.summary-label.svelte-1uha8ag{font-size:.875rem;color:#0a0;margin-bottom:.5rem}.summary-value.svelte-1uha8ag{font-size:1.5rem;font-weight:700;color:#0f0}.files-section.svelte-1uha8ag{margin-bottom:2rem}.files-section.svelte-1uha8ag h3:where(.svelte-1uha8ag){font-size:1.25rem;color:#0f0;margin-bottom:1rem}.files-list.svelte-1uha8ag{display:flex;flex-direction:column;gap:.75rem}.file-item.svelte-1uha8ag{display:flex;justify-content:space-between;align-items:center;padding:1rem;background:#00ff0005;border:1px solid #00ff00}.file-item-name.svelte-1uha8ag{color:#0f0;font-weight:600}.file-item-size.svelte-1uha8ag{color:#0a0;font-size:.875rem}.usage-info.svelte-1uha8ag{background:#00ff0005;border:1px solid #00ff00;padding:2rem;margin-bottom:2rem}.usage-info.svelte-1uha8ag h3:where(.svelte-1uha8ag){color:#0f0;margin-bottom:1.5rem;font-size:1.25rem}.usage-steps.svelte-1uha8ag{display:flex;flex-direction:column;gap:1rem}.usage-step.svelte-1uha8ag{padding:1rem;background:#00ff000d;border-left:3px solid #00ff00}.usage-step.svelte-1uha8ag strong:where(.svelte-1uha8ag){color:#0f0;display:block;margin-bottom:.5rem}.usage-step.svelte-1uha8ag p:where(.svelte-1uha8ag){color:#0a0;margin:.25rem 0}.usage-step.svelte-1uha8ag code:where(.svelte-1uha8ag){background:#000;padding:.25rem .5rem;border:1px solid #00ff00;color:#0f0;font-family:inherit}.footer.svelte-1uha8ag{background:#000;border-top:2px solid #00ff00;padding:2rem;text-align:center;color:#0a0;margin-top:auto}.footer-content.svelte-1uha8ag{display:flex;flex-direction:column;align-items:center;gap:1rem}.footer-title.svelte-1uha8ag{margin:0;font-size:.875rem}.social-links.svelte-1uha8ag{display:flex;gap:1.5rem;align-items:center}.social-link.svelte-1uha8ag{display:flex;align-items:center;gap:.5rem;color:#0f0;text-decoration:none;padding:.5rem 1rem;border:1px solid #00ff00;border-radius:4px;transition:all .3s ease;font-size:.875rem}.social-link.svelte-1uha8ag:hover{background:#0f0;color:#0a0e14;box-shadow:0 0 20px #00ff0080;transform:translateY(-2px)}.footer.svelte-1uha8ag p:where(.svelte-1uha8ag){margin:.25rem 0;font-size:.875rem}.footer.svelte-1uha8ag strong:where(.svelte-1uha8ag){color:#0f0}.footer-warning.svelte-1uha8ag{color:#fa0;margin:0}
